Princess Christina, Mrs. Magnuson - Swedish princess; elder sister of King Carl XVI Gustaf of Sweden. Article "Kristina Švedska Magnuson" in Slovenian Wikipedia has 29.8 points for quality (as of November 1, 2023). The article contains 4 references and 7 sections.

Wikipedia readers most often find their way to information on Princess Christina, Mrs. Magnuson from Wikipedia articles about Prince Gustaf Adolf, Duke of Västerbotten, Princess Sibylla of Saxe-Coburg and Gotha, Carl XVI Gustaf of Sweden, Swedish royal family and Princess Birgitta of Sweden. Whereas reading the article about Princess Christina, Mrs. Magnuson people most often go to Wikipedia articles on Tord Magnuson, Prince Gustaf Adolf, Duke of Västerbotten, Princess Sibylla of Saxe-Coburg and Gotha, Carl XVI Gustaf of Sweden and Princess Désirée, Baroness Silfverschiöld.

The WikiRank project is intended for automatic relative evaluation of the articles in the various language versions of Wikipedia. At the moment the service allows to compare over 44 million Wikipedia articles in 55 languages. Quality scores of articles are based on Wikipedia dumps from November, 2023. When calculating current popularity and AI of articles data from October 2023 was taken into account. For historical values of popularity and AI WikiRank used data from 2001 to 2023...
